Upkeep Tips for Homeowners
As a property owner, prioritizing regular maintenance of your plumbing system is necessary to ensure its longevity and performance. One of one of the most critical steps is to perform regular evaluations for leakages, rust, or indicators of wear in pipelines and components. Tequa. Early discovery can avoid expensive fixings and minimize water damages
Furthermore, frequently examine and cleanse your drains pipes to avoid clogs. Employing a mix of vinegar and baking soda can properly break down minor build-ups, keeping your drainage system flowing efficiently. It is additionally crucial to evaluate your hot water heater each year, purging it to eliminate index sediment build-up, which can hinder its efficiency.
Display your water pressure; excessively high pressure can strain your pipes, causing leakages or bursts - Tequa. Installing a stress regulatory authority can assist keep ideal levels. Moreover, think about seasonal maintenance, such as insulating visit this web-site pipelines prior to winter to stop cold and potential tears.
Last but not least, familiarize on your own with the location of your major water shut-off valve. In emergency situations, knowing just how to promptly switch off your supply of water can avoid extensive damage. By carrying out these maintenance pointers, house owners can endure an effective plumbing system and improve general home safety and security.
